Crime overview

Millers Close area has the 7th highest crime rate of 51 local areas in Leighton-Linslade North , and the 45th highest crime rate of 874 local areas in Central Bedfordshire .

This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Millers Close (LU7 3YQ) in the last 12 months was 204.6 per 1,000 residents and was 284.7% higher than the Leighton-Linslade North average (53.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 31 offences recorded. The least common crime was Possession of weapons with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 50.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-33.3%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 36 (≈ 102.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-14.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-49.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Millers Close (LU7 3YQ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Meadow Way, where police recorded 30 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Sports/Recreation Area (22 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
